Except KO, IIKO: Clean the air cleaner element using compressed air from the throttle body side any time it is excessively dirty. KO, IIKO types: Replace the air cleaner element in accordance with the maintenance schedule or any time it is excessively dirty or damage. • The viscous paper element type air cleaner (KO, IIKO types) cannot be cleaned because the element contains a dust adhesive. Installation is in the reverse order of removal. TORQUE: Screw: 1.1 N·m (0.1 kgf·m, 0.8 lbf·ft) SOLENOID VALVE CONNECTOR 27-80 dummyhead CBR1000RR/RA-C ADDENDUM FRONT WHEEL INSPECTION Wheel balance • Wheel balance directly affects the stability, handling and overall safety of the motorcycle. Always check balance whenever the tire has been removed from the rim. • For optimum balance, the tire balance mark (a paint dot on the side wall) must be located next to the valve stem. Remount the tire if necessary. • Mount the tire with the arrow mark facing in the direction of rotation. • Stick-type balance weights should be used on this motorcycle. Use genuine Honda balance weights. – Before installing the weights, remove any adhesive from the rim thoroughly and clean the area where new weights are to be placed with degreasing agent. Take care not to scratch the rim surface. – Do not touch the adhesive surface of the weight with your bare hands when installing. – The balance weights are always replaced with new ones whenever they are removed. Do not reuse them. BALANCE MARK VALVE STEM ARROW Wheel Rotating Direction Mount the wheel, tire and brake discs assembly in an inspection stand. Spin the wheel, allow it to stop, and mark the lowest (heaviest) point of the wheel with a chalk. Do this two or three times to verify the heaviest area. If the wheel is balanced, it will not stop consistently in the same position. INSPECTION STAND To balance the wheel, install the wheel weights on the highest side of the rim, on the side opposite the chalk marks. Add just enough weight so the wheel will no longer stop in the same position when it is spun. Do not add more than 60 g to the wheel. Press the weights by your hands firmly and make sure they are not come off the rim. • The weights are attached to the position at 5 mm (front)/7.5 mm (rear) from the side surface of the rim in the direction as shown. • If the weight exceeds 10 g, install same amount of the balance weights on the right and left symmetrical position. (Check for a short circuit in the related wires if the fuse is blown again) • The starter motor should operate with the following conditions. – transmission is in neural or clutch lever squeezed with sidestand retracted – ignition switch turned ON – starter/lap switch pushed • This model is equipped with a lap timer. The starter switch is used for timer operation as well as for starting the engine. These two functions of the switch are changed automatically depending upon the mode of the combination meter. The change is made via the lap relay (page 27-107). The starter/lap switch functions as the lap timer switch when the combination meter is in lap time mode and with the engine running. The switch reverts to its primary starting function when the combination meter is displaying standard information or when the engine is stopped. Starter motor does not turn 1. Yellow/green (Viewed from the terminal side) 27-103 dummyhead CBR1000RR/RA-C ADDENDUM EOP SWITCH INSPECTION • The oil pressure indicator should come on when the ignition switch is turned ON with the engine stopped and goes off while the engine is running in normal operating pressure. Indicator does not come on when the ignition switch is turned ON Remove the dust cover, and disconnect the switch wire by removing the terminal bolt (page 20-14). Ground the wire terminal with a jumper wire. Turn the ignition switch ON and check the oil pressure indicator. The indicator should come on. • If the indicator comes on, replace the EOP switch. • If the indicator does not come on, check for an open circuit in the Black and Blue/red wires between the switch and combination meter. If wires are OK, replace the combination meter. OIL PRESSURE INDICATOR BOLT Indicator stays on while the engine is running Check the engine oil pressure (page 5-5). If it is normal, inspect as follows. Start the engine with the EOP switch wire disconnected and check the oil pressure indicator. • If the indicator does not come on, replace the EOP switch. • If the indicator stays on, check for a short circuit in the Black and Blue/red wires between the switch and combination meter. If wires are OK, replace the combination meter.
